Often in novels, symbols are present. In Ayn Rand’s Anthem, candles provide the only source of light in the world in which Equality lives. This is the literal source of light. A symbolic meaning of the light is knowledge. The symbol of light is used throughout the novel to illustrate how the society limits knowledge and how humans have a natural pursuit for knowledge. Symbols represent something other than themselves, which is significant to the story. The symbol of light is used to illustrate how Equality’s society limits knowledge.
